Shake Roof Replacement Costs Overview
 
 High-quality shakes tend to cost more but offer greater durability and aesthetic appeal.
 
 Larger roofs require more materials and labor, increasing overall replacement costs.
 
 Architectural features and accessibility can influence labor costs and project duration.
| Factor | Impact on Cost | 
|---|---|
| Material Type | Premium cedar shakes are more expensive than standard options. | 
| Roof Size | Larger roofs increase material and labor costs. | 
| Pitch and Complexity | Steeper or complex roofs require additional safety measures and time. | 
| Location | Regional labor rates and material availability affect pricing. | 
| Removal of Old Roofing | Removing existing roofing adds to total costs. | 
| Underlayment and Accessories | Additional layers and hardware contribute to expenses. | 
| Permits and Inspections | Necessary for compliance, influencing overall cost. | 
| Weather Conditions | Adverse weather can delay work and increase costs. | 
The cost of shake roof replacement varies significantly based on the factors outlined above. On average, property owners may expect to pay a range that reflects material choices, roof dimensions, and site-specific conditions. Proper planning and consultation with professionals can help determine accurate estimates tailored to individual project requirements.

| Service | Average Price Range | 
|---|---|
| Basic Shake Roof Replacement | $10,000 - $20,000 | 
| Premium Shake Roof Replacement | $20,000 - $30,000 | 
| Complete Roof Inspection | $300 - $600 | 
| Old Roof Removal | $1,000 - $3,000 | 
| Underlayment Installation | $1,500 - $3,000 | 
| Roof Ventilation Upgrade | $1,000 - $2,500 | 
| Flashing Replacement | $500 - $1,500 | 
| Permitting and Inspection | $200 - $800 | 
| Structural Repairs | $2,000 - $5,000 | 
| Emergency Temporary Cover | $1,000 - $2,500 |
